When a pharmaceutical company puts a potentially dangerous medication on the market, they are under an obligation to thoroughly test it and warn consumers of any risks that could be present. They must also ensure the medication is effective and does not cause harm when taken in the manner prescribed. In the event of the course of a lawsuit, a risky drug lawyer might argue that the defendant did not fulfill these obligations and therefore is liable for a claimant's losses.

Many times, the side effects of a drug are not recognized until it has been made available for mass production and widespread use. These potentially harmful adverse effects are then revealed to thousands of people. In certain instances the drug is recalled but not before it has harmed thousands of people. Hospitals, doctors and pharmacies could be held responsible in some instances for prescribing or dispensing dangerous medications which are not properly labelled or administered. However most of the time it is the drug companies who are the ones that cause harm to patients. These corporations often prioritize profits and growth over patient safety and have a flawed regulatory oversight system. Overloaded FDA inspectors, for example, may not be able properly audit research or check facilities. Loopholes permit drugs to be approved for sale even after thorough testing has been completed. Distribution channels usually offer financial incentives to keep drugs on the market even if they're not safe.

The damages that a victim can get in a lawsuit against a pharmaceutical firm include past and future medical expenses as well as loss of income because of a lack of ability to work, and suffering and pain. Additionally, a victim can pursue damages for the loss of companionship and consortium if the injuries have affected their relationship with their spouse or family members.

It's because they fail to conduct adequate research before putting a medication on the market, fail to include warnings that could be dangerous or even knowingly release defective drugs on the market pharmaceutical companies could be liable for any injuries or illness that results from an over-the-counter or prescription drug.

Most often, a hazard drug lawsuit involves prescription and over-the-counter medications such as pain relievers, heart medication, antidepressants, acne medications diet pills, even birth control. In other cases victims are injured due to a doctor prescribing the wrong dosage of medication or prescribed a medication that is harmful when combined together with other medications. One can also be injured due to an error in manufacturing or due to the drug being infected with a harmful ingredient.

You could be entitled to compensation for economic damages, such as medical expenses or lost wages due to complications that resulted from your use of drugs. You may also be awarded non-economic damages, like pain and suffering, disfigurement, and loss of enjoyment life.

In many cases, a drug company will be held accountable for both types of damages. They did not provide patients with the proper instructions regarding how to use their medications and warn them of possible adverse effects. They could also be held accountable for punitive damages, which are designed to punish the drug maker for their negligent actions.

The FDA has linked a number of drugs to serious health issues. Certain of them have been recalled by the manufacturers. For instance, Zantac, a popular heartburn medication was recently recalled because of it containing the chemical NDMA that is linked to cancer.
